This is a full-time, on-site position based at Pixel’s satellite location in Cedar Knolls, NJ. The schedule for this role rotates between 9 am and 11:30 am ET start times throughout the week, with participation in a monthly Saturday rotation from 9 am to 3 pm ET. •Provide compassionate, accurate, and timely support to patients through phone calls, messages, and other communication channels. •Support patient onboarding by gathering, confirming, and accurately documenting patient, prescription, medication, allergy, insurance, and other required information. •Coordinate medication scheduling, refill requests, shipment arrangements, and other activities needed to support timely medication fulfillment. •Respond to patient questions about medication status, scheduling, refills, shipments, documentation requirements, available resources, and general pharmacy services. •Educate patients on the medication fulfillment process, shipment expectations, available resources, and what to expect next. •Resolve patient questions and service needs within the scope of your role and follow through on commitments made during patient interactions. Qualifications: •High school diploma or equivalent. •Active pharmacy technician registration in New Jersey. •Eligibility and willingness to obtain pharmacy technician registrations in Texas, and additional states as business needs require upon hire. •Strong written and verbal communication skills with a compassionate, patient-centered approach. •Excellent attention to detail and the ability to accurately manage a high volume of patient information, documentation, and tasks. •Strong organizational and time-management skills with the ability to prioritize needs and proactively move work forward. •Strong problem-solving skills and a willingness to investigate and resolve issues rather than simply identify the problem. •Sound judgment and the ability to recognize when a patient question, clinical concern, or service issue requires support from another team or resource. •Demonstrated capacity to work independently while collaborating effectively with patients, pharmacists, providers, and cross-functional team members. •Demonstrated capacity to thrive in a fast-paced environment while maintaining accuracy, professionalism, and attention to detail.
